2. Cookie Preferences: When you first visit our website, you have the choice to accept or reject non-essential cookies via our cookie consent banner. You can change your cookie preferences at any time by clicking the “Change Cookie Consent” link (usually found in the website footer or in this Legal & Compliance section). Using that tool, you can adjust which categories of cookies you allow – for instance, you could disable analytics or advertising cookies while keeping essential ones. If you prefer, you can also control cookies through your web browser settings. Each browser (Chrome, Firefox, Safari, Edge, etc.) allows you to block or delete cookies. You can set your browser to prompt you before accepting cookies, or to block cookies by default. Please consult your browser’s help documentation for specific instructions (see our Cookies Policy for helpful links). Keep in mind that disabling cookies might affect some website functionality (as explained in the Cookies Policy). We encourage you to use our on-site tools for a more granular approach (so you can reject advertising cookies but keep site-functional ones, for example). Your cookie choices made via our tool will be remembered through a cookie on your browser; if you clear your cookies, you may need to set your preferences again.

5. Do Not Track: “Do Not Track” (DNT) is a setting available in most web browsers that signals to websites that you do not want to be tracked. Currently, there is no universal standard for how websites should respond to DNT signals, and as such, our website may not react to a generic DNT header. Instead, we rely on the mechanisms described above (cookie consent, opt-out links, GPC) to manage opt-outs. We will continue to monitor developments around Do Not Track and will honor any required signals if standards emerge. In the meantime, using our cookie tool or GPC is the most effective way to communicate your preferences to us.
